What Affects Electrical Repair Costs in Obernburg?
Understanding pricing factors helps you budget accurately and avoid surprises
labor costs
Obernburg is a small rural community in Sullivan County, which means local electrical contractors often have to factor in travel time and mileage to reach your property. Labor rates in the Catskills region tend to reflect the cost of doing business in a less densely populated area — fewer electricians means less competition, which can keep rates on the higher side compared to more urban parts of the state. Most pros charge a service call fee that covers the trip out, and that fee can vary depending on how far they're coming from.
market dynamics
Sullivan County has seen a steady influx of second-home owners and seasonal residents, which drives demand for electrical services — especially during peak seasons. With a limited pool of licensed electricians serving the Obernburg area, high-demand periods can mean longer wait times and potentially higher rates for urgent repairs. Getting on a contractor's schedule in advance for non-emergency work can help you avoid premium pricing.
seasonal trends
Electrical repair pricing in Obernburg can shift with the seasons. Spring and summer are typically the busiest times as homeowners tackle renovations and outdoor projects. Winter storms can also spike demand for emergency electrical repairs, particularly after power outages or weather damage. If your repair isn't urgent, fall and early winter often see lighter schedules, which may work in your favor for availability and pricing.
🧱 Key Pricing Components
- ✓ Service call or trip fee — covers the electrician's travel time and fuel to reach your Obernburg property
- ✓ Diagnostic or assessment fee — the cost to inspect and identify the electrical issue before any repair work begins
- ✓ Hourly labor rate — time spent on the actual repair, which can vary based on the electrician's experience and license level
- ✓ Materials and parts — wiring, outlets, breakers, switches, or specialty components needed for the repair
- ✓ Permit and inspection fees — required for certain types of electrical work in Sullivan County
- ✓ Emergency or after-hours surcharge — additional fees for calls made outside normal business hours or on weekends
Typical Electrical Repair Costs
Average pricing for common services in Obernburg
Electrical repair costs in Obernburg can vary widely depending on the scope of work. Minor repairs like replacing a faulty outlet or switch often fall on the lower end, while more involved jobs like troubleshooting recurring breaker trips or repairing damaged wiring sit in the mid-range. Major work — such as upgrading a panel or running new circuits — can run significantly higher.
Keep in mind that most electricians in the area charge a service call or diagnostic fee that covers the first trip out. This fee typically offsets travel costs and may or may not be applied toward the final repair bill, depending on the contractor. Always ask how the diagnostic fee works before authorizing any work.
The best way to get an accurate picture for your specific job is to request itemized quotes from at least three licensed electricians serving Obernburg. This helps you compare not just the total price, but the breakdown of labor, materials, and fees.

Pricing Questions
Common questions about electrical repair costs in Obernburg
💬 How much does an electrician charge for a service call in Obernburg?
Most electricians serving Obernburg charge a service call or trip fee that covers their travel time and mileage from their base of operation. This fee can vary based on how far they need to drive to reach your property. Always ask upfront whether this fee applies to the cost of the repair if you decide to move forward with the same contractor.
💬 Do I need a permit for electrical repairs in Obernburg, NY?
Yes, many electrical repairs in Sullivan County require a permit and inspection to ensure the work meets local building codes. Simple tasks like replacing an outlet or switch may not need one, but any work involving new wiring, circuit changes, or panel work typically does. A licensed electrician can advise you on what permits are needed for your specific job.
💬 Why do electricians charge a diagnostic fee before doing repairs?
The diagnostic or assessment fee covers the time and expertise required to safely identify the root cause of an electrical problem. Some issues aren't obvious and require testing, troubleshooting, and specialized tools. This fee ensures the electrician is compensated for that initial evaluation, regardless of whether you proceed with the repair.
💬 Should I hire an electrician from a bigger city or a local Obernburg pro?
Local electricians who serve Obernburg regularly are familiar with the area's housing stock, common electrical setups, and county inspection requirements. Travel fees from contractors based in larger towns may be higher. Hiring locally can also mean faster response times, especially in an emergency.
💬 What's the difference between hourly rates and flat-rate pricing for electrical work?
Some electricians charge by the hour for labor, while others offer flat-rate pricing for common repairs like replacing an outlet or installing a light fixture. Flat-rate pricing can make it easier to compare quotes, but hourly billing may be more transparent for complex jobs where the scope is unclear upfront. Ask which model they use when requesting your estimate.
💬 How can I tell if an electrical repair quote is fair?
The best way to gauge fairness is to compare itemized quotes from at least three licensed electricians. Look for consistency in the labor and materials estimates. Be wary of quotes that are significantly lower or higher than the others, and don't hesitate to ask for clarification on any line item you don't understand.
